In this ninth installment of the series Paradigm Shifts in Perspective, Drs. Roth, Halegoua-De Marzio, and Guglielmo describe the application of mag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) to the diagnosis of gastrointestinal and liver diseases in an enlightening, comprehensive, and detailed review. MRI represents the culmination of over a century of scientific investigation, the bulk of which was in particle physics, with scarce recognition of its clinical applicability until the late 1970s. MRI is perhaps one of the greatest triumphs of translational medicine: the transformation of important discoveries made in the most fundamental of scientific disciplines, particle physics, into a powerful and essentially safe diagnostic medical technique. …
